hi got an orion 1.8 zetec just have a couple off questions before i put the 2L in can i use the 2L ecu and inlet manifold and keep the 1.8 loom or do i need to put the 2L loom in place of the 1.8 also do i need to use the fly wheel, sump and pickup pipe from the 1.8? any other info would be greatly recieved cheers adam

You need the sump, inlet, water pump and (not essential) flywheel from your 1.8. Swap it all over then compare the wiring diagrams of the 2 ECU to see if you need to move pins about. If the 2.0 ECU has PATS you will need to find one the hasn't got PATs.

You'll probably find you can't just plug the 2.0 ECU in.
All depends on whether the PATS and EDIS are external or not.
Obviously anything is possibly, where there is a will there is a way but just dont expect to plug it in and fire it up.
